Avoiding Common Mistakes
Despite the best intentions and strategies, many sports bettors fall victim to common mistakes that can derail their long-term success. Some of these mistakes include:
1. Chasing losses: Trying to recoup losses by increasing bet sizes or taking unnecessary risks.
2. Overconfidence: Believing that you have a foolproof betting system that guarantees success.
3. Ignoring bankroll management: Failing to set a budget or sticking to it, leading to financial losses.
4. Emotional betting: Allowing emotions to dictate betting decisions, rather than logic and strategy.
5. Following the crowd: Placing bets based on popular opinion or trends, rather than conducting independent research.
By recognizing and avoiding these common mistakes, sports bettors can enhance their discipline and improve their chances of long-term success.
